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Malayan Water Shrew | Mandarin dogfish |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Elasmobranchii |
| Order | Soricomorpha (Soricomorpha) | Squaliformes (Squaliformes) |
| Family | Soricidae | Squalidae |
| Genus | Chimarrogale | Cirrhigaleus |
| Species | Chimarrogale hantu | Cirrhigaleus barbifer |
Evolutionary Relationship
Malayan Water Shrew and Mandarin dogfish share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
